COURT SERVICES VICTORIA ACT 2014 - SECT 11

Functions and powers of the Courts Council

In addition to the performance of the function and the exercise of the powers of Court Services Victoria, the Courts Council has the following functions and powers—

        (a)     to direct the strategy, governance and risk management of Court Services Victoria;

        (b)     to appoint, in accordance with this Act—

              (i)     the Chief Executive Officer of Court Services Victoria; and

              (ii)     a Court Chief Executive Officer for each jurisdiction;

        (c)     any other functions and powers conferred on it by or under this or any other Act.
